Why SMEs Are Targets • Limited budgets • No dedicated security • Valuable data • Easier to breach
Cost of Ignoring Cybersecurity • Downtime = revenue loss • Data loss = trust damage • High recovery cost
Threat 1 – Phishing • Fake emails trick employees • Leads to stolen data • Tip: Verify emails
Threat 2 – Ransomware • Files locked by attackers • Payment demanded • Tip: Backup data regularly
Threat 3 – BEC • Fake CEO/vendor emails • Urgent payment scams • Tip: Verify transactions
Threat 4 – Weak Passwords • Easy to guess passwords • Reuse risks • Tip: Use MFA
Threat 5 – Insider Threats • Employee mistakes or misuse • Tip: Limit access
Threat 6 – Remote Access Risks • Unsecured remote work • Tip: Secure VPN + MFA
Threat 7 – Supply Chain • Attack via vendors • Tip: Vet partners
Threat 8 – AI Attacks • Smarter phishing • Tip: Awareness training
Threat 9 – Device Risks • Lost/stolen devices • Tip: Remote wipe
Threat 10 – Unpatched Software • Outdated systems vulnerable • Tip: Update regularly
